Pros

Nice co-workers, and that is about it...

Cons

Where should I start? Terrible pay, terrible managers, an old equipment that breaks down very often. They'd blame employees and write them up for bad production due to bad equipment. They forced employees to work overtime almost every weekend and wouldn't give a heads up about it-especially 3rd shift. They are ALWAYS behind in production. One of the supervisors would break confidentiality and give information to other fellow employees that should only be between the supervisor, the manager, and that particular employee like that's not grounds for a lawsuit. The place is structured: you eat at the same time as everyone, you take a break at the same time as everyone. There's a high turnover so they force employees to learn more tests for the same pay. Honestly, I never new a job could make a person so miserable. They know they can treat people poorly because there aren't any jobs out here. It's a miracle another job offered me a position a few days before I was just about to quit.
